Exactly what are commitment anarchy, and how have you any idea should you pertain this union pointers to your lifestyle?
Commitment anarchy is defined as “…the notion that relationships really should not be bound by principles irrespective of precisely what the men and women involved collectively agree upon.”
In my experience, union anarchy means publishing the principles, and tissues, of interactions that society instills in you. It really is about personalizing your relationships to fulfill your needs and those of the people you’re in a relationship with — whether it’s romantic, platonic, sexual, or any mixture of the aforementioned.
